Beulah Mae Venable, 99, of Reynolds, passed away on Monday, January 23, 2023, at the Clarissa C. Cook Hospice House, Bettendorf. Funeral services will be 10 a.m. Saturday, January 28, 2023, at Reynolds United Methodist Church. Visitation will be from 4 to 7 p.m. Friday, January 27, 2023, at Wheelan-Pressly Funeral Home and Crematory, 801 W. Edgington Street, Reynolds. Burial will be in Reynolds Cemetery.
Beulah was born October 19, 1923, in Edgington Township. She was the daughter of Ernest and Retta (Whitney) Mueller. She graduated from Reynolds High School and Western Illinois University, Macomb, IL with a degree in Elementary Education. She taught school in rural one room schools, last teaching in the Rockridge School District at Illinois City Grade School. She married Melvin Venable on June 22, 1955, in the Reynolds United Methodist Church. She was also a member of the Blackhawk Unit of the Illinois Retired Teachers Association.
For 20 years she also wrote a column for the Aledo Times Record newspaper with the weekly news of the Reynolds area. Beulah loved attending her grandchildren’s games, traveling to college basketball games and college baseball games to cheer them on. Recently, she attended her great-grandson’s baseball game and was very excited to be able to say she was on her third generation of being a fan.
She is survived by her 2 children; Frank (Sandra) Venable, and Susan (Melvin) Blaser. She had two grandsons, Tucker (Anna) Blaser and Tyson (Holley) Blaser; and one step-granddaughter, Chelsy (Nate) Cady. She has 5 great-grandchildren.
She was preceded in death by her parents, Ernest and Retta Mueller; her husband, Melvin Venable; her sister, Doris Thomason; and her brother, Virgil Mueller.
